In “Manitou Canyon,” the fifteenth installment in William Kent Krueger’s Cork O’Connor mystery series, readers are once again taken on a thrilling journey through the rugged landscapes of the Minnesota wilderness. The novel opens with Cork O’Connor, former sheriff turned private investigator, embarking on a dangerous search for a missing young woman named Shiloh, who disappeared during a canoe trip in the remote Manitou Canyon.

Krueger’s masterful storytelling shines through in this gripping tale of suspense, as Cork navigates through treacherous terrain and faces dangerous adversaries in his quest to find Shiloh. The author’s vivid descriptions of the Northwoods setting immerse readers in the beauty and harshness of the wilderness, adding depth and atmosphere to the novel.

The character of Cork O’Connor continues to be a compelling and complex protagonist, grappling with personal demons and moral dilemmas as he unravels the mystery behind Shiloh’s disappearance. Krueger skillfully weaves together elements of Native American culture, environmental issues, and family dynamics, creating a multi-layered narrative that keeps readers engaged from start to finish.

The pacing of “Manitou Canyon” is expertly crafted, with twists and turns that keep the reader guessing until the very end. Krueger’s prose is lyrical and evocative, painting a vivid portrait of the Northwoods and its inhabitants. The author’s deep respect and understanding of the natural world shines through in his writing, adding a richness and authenticity to the story.

Overall, “Manitou Canyon” is a captivating and thought-provoking mystery that will appeal to fans of the genre and new readers alike. William Kent Krueger’s skillful storytelling and his ability to create a sense of time and place make this novel a standout in the Cork O’Connor series. With its blend of suspense, intrigue, and richly drawn characters, “Manitou Canyon” is a must-read for anyone looking for a thrilling and immersive mystery novel.
